European nightcrawlers

Populace density of regarding 100 worms per 1/2 a square foot (300 worms for a 10 gallon Rubbermaid container)

Bed in peat moss (shredded cardboard or comparable may additionally function).

Feed a high nitrogen diet regimen like hen feed (vegetable scraps like those used in composting systems are too variable in nutrition)

Making a home for your worms can really can be as easy as drilling a couple of openings in a plastic or foam container, filling it with some shredded cardboard or paper (do not use printed or dyed paper as it can be hazardous to the worms), adding a number of inches of dust or potting dirt, and sprinkling on a little bit of water to permit the soil to be wet, yet not soggy
